Package cruise.umple.util
Class Json
java.lang.Object
cruise.umple.util.Json
public class Json
extends java.lang.Object
-
Constructor Summary
Constructors Constructor Description Json(java.lang.String aName, java.lang.String aValue)
-
Method Summary
Modifier and Type Method Description boolean
addArray(Json aArray)
void
addArrayEntity(java.lang.String value)
boolean
addComposite(Json aComposite)
void
addComposite(java.lang.String name, java.lang.String value)
void
delete()
Json
getArray(int index)
Json[]
getArray(java.lang.String name)
Json[]
getArrays()
Json
getAttribute(java.lang.String name)
Json
getComposite(int index)
Json[]
getComposites()
int
getIntValue()
int
getIntValue(java.lang.String name)
java.lang.String
getName()
java.lang.String
getValue()
java.lang.String
getValue(java.lang.String name)
boolean
hasArrays()
boolean
hasComposites()
int
indexOfArray(Json aArray)
int
indexOfComposite(Json aComposite)
boolean
isComposite()
int
numberOfArrays()
int
numberOfComposites()
boolean
removeArray(Json aArray)
boolean
removeComposite(Json aComposite)
boolean
setName(java.lang.String aName)
boolean
setValue(java.lang.String aValue)
java.lang.String
toString()
-
Constructor Details
-
Json
public Json(java.lang.String aName, java.lang.String aValue)
-
-
Method Details
-
setName
public boolean setName(java.lang.String aName) -
setValue
public boolean setValue(java.lang.String aValue) -
addComposite
-
removeComposite
-
addArray
-
removeArray
-
getName
public java.lang.String getName() -
getValue
public java.lang.String getValue() -
getComposite
-
getComposites
-
numberOfComposites
public int numberOfComposites() -
hasComposites
public boolean hasComposites() -
indexOfComposite
-
getArray
-
getArrays
-
numberOfArrays
public int numberOfArrays() -
hasArrays
public boolean hasArrays() -
indexOfArray
-
delete
public void delete() -
isComposite
public boolean isComposite() -
addComposite
public void addComposite(java.lang.String name, java.lang.String value) -
addArrayEntity
public void addArrayEntity(java.lang.String value) -
getIntValue
public int getIntValue(java.lang.String name) -
getArray
-
getAttribute
-
getValue
public java.lang.String getValue(java.lang.String name) -
getIntValue
public int getIntValue() -
toString
public java.lang.String toString()- Overrides:
toString
in classjava.lang.Object
-